Article: County health department recommends flu shots

Unlike in previous years, the DuPage County Health Department does not expect delays in its vaccine this flu season, which typically runs from November until April and peaks in January.

"The health department anticipates enough vaccine for 9,000 flu shots," public information specialist David Hass said.

He said earlier budget cuts, which forced the department to eliminate its gerontology program, won't have a direct impact on its administering flu inoculations.

Leland Lewis, the department's executive director, said the flu vaccine does not always protect a person from getting the illness. But the vaccine is 70 percent to 90 percent effective in preventing flu among healthy adults ...
